PUBLIC HEARING ID 15-0519 A Request to Rezone Tract 107, Block 2, Lots 95, 96A and 96B; 282 Lake Havasu Avenue North and 1620 & 1622 Palo Verde Boulevard South, from R-1, Single-Family Residential, to C-1, Limited Commercial District. Mr. Schmeling thanked the Chairman and presented a PowerPoint slideshow and narrative including some of the following key points: • Property address and description • Current zoning description • Zoning of surrounding properties • Proposed and existing General Plans support Commercial zoning in this area Mr. McGowan asked if there was a structure on the corner. Mr. Schmeling responded yes, one of the three lots are vacant and the other two have residential homes which would have to be demolished as a result of any commercial development. The request is to rezone the property to C-1. The applicant is associated with El Pollo Loco for a restaurant; the Commission has to consider that once the property is rezoned any commercial use allowed in the C-1 District would be allowed to go in that location. That is why we provided the list of all uses allowed in the C-1 District. Mr. Bergen asked if there were two vacant lots. Mr. Schmeling explained that no, the lots are odd shaped. Chairman Harris opened the Public Hearing. Hearing none, he closed the Public Hearing. Mr. Schmeling stated that Staff finds the proposed rezoning meets all the requirements set forth in 14.56.080 (B). Based on the findings, the Development Review Committee recommends that land use action 15-0519 be forwarded to City Council with a recommendation of approval for Tract 107, Block 2, Lots 95, 96A & 96B, rezoning the properties from R-1 to C-1, Limited Commercial District.
